What is RTP?

RTP, or Return to Player, is a crucial metric that every slot enthusiast should understand. This percentage represents how much money a slot machine returns to players over an extended period of time. For example, if a game has an RTP of 96%, it means that for every $100 wagered, the game theoretically returns $96 to players in winnings.

Why RTP Matters

Understanding RTP helps players make informed decisions about which slots to play. Higher RTP percentages generally mean better long-term value for your bankroll. Most reputable online casinos display this information clearly, allowing you to compare different games before spinning the reels.

Average RTP Ranges

Online slots typically feature RTP percentages between 92% and 98%. Licensed casinos ensure their games meet strict regulatory standards, guaranteeing fair gameplay. When selecting where to play, always verify that the platform is certified and transparent about their game mechanics.

The Bottom Line

While RTP doesn’t guarantee short-term success, it’s an essential factor in responsible gambling. Combine this knowledge with proper bankroll management and realistic expectations for the best gaming experience. Remember that slots are games of chance, and entertainment value should be your primary focus rather than potential winnings.
